I don't know much about NCAA signing rules and whatnot, but when is Bailey able to sign with an NHL team? And would you happen to know if the Avs are looking at anyone else? (Like Ahti Oksanen)

Any NCAA free agent is eligible to sign at any time, but they will no longer be eligible for their college team. So realistically it will happen after a team's season is over. I don't know if the Avs are in on any other college free agent.
